Kindness is both a fruit of the Spirit and a command. It is not optional, because you and I are meant for kindness. In fact, God often uses the smallest acts of kindness to leave the biggest legacy. Take Tabitha, for example. She made clothing for widows. She does the same thing over and over, every single day. She sews. That’s it. It’s not glamorous. It may even be a bit monotonous. But God uses her service in an extraordinary way, not only to leave a legacy in the lives of others but to demonstrate God’s great power in Her life. Interestingly, the Greek word for “kind” looks almost exactly like the Greek word for “Christ”. There is only one letter different. In the first century, those early followers of Jesus were so kind to others that many people got confused as to whether their title was “follower of Christ” or “follower of Kindness.” They literally sometimes confused the two. Truth is, if we are followers of Jesus, we are also called to be followers of kindness. Because our Jesus is so, so kind.
